Sakuran (2006,  Unrated)
Sakuran 5.0 Stars
Moulin Rouge! in Japanese. A vivid insight into the mizu-shobai of a Yoshiwara courtesan with flowery dreams. The imagery is over-the-top picturesque because the director started off as a pro photographer. Beats Hero & Color Blossoms any day, and only narrowly loses out to Rouge! coz of the lack of singing. But the falling sakura is a sight to behold.
